首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 开发语言 > VB >

关于vb打包有关问题?(谢谢了)

2012-01-08 
关于vb打包问题?(多谢了)我没有用ADO打开数据库,我是用语句打开的定义如下:PublicrsAsNewADODB.RecordsetP

关于vb打包问题?(多谢了)
我没有用ADO打开数据库,我是用语句打开的定义如下:
Public   rs   As   New   ADODB.Recordset
Public   cnn   As   New   ADODB.Connection
dim   Ssql   as   string
Ssql   =   "select     *   from   hao   "
Smdbpath   =   App.Path   &   "\3d.mdb "
cnn.Open   "Provider=Microsoft.Jet.OLEDB.3.51;Data   Source= "   &   Smdbpath
rs.CursorLocation   =   adUseServer
rs.Open   Ssql,   cnn,   adOpenStatic,   adLockOptimistic
我用VB自带的打包或用HAP_SetupFactory7-LDR&WestKing打包,2000下打了一个XP下打了一个.但打好后,在没有安VB的机器上调试都提示驱动没有找到(用语句打开数据库的驱动).有哪位大侠知道应如何解决多谢了.

[解决办法]
手工再安装mdac2.8mdactyp.exe,将OLEDB.3.51改成OLEDB.4.0
[解决办法]
用InstallShield吧,它内置的有MDAC的模块,直接就帮你安装了。另外楼主的数据访问技术好像确实有点过时了点?……我也觉得用Jet4.0好一点吧。Jet3.51好像是当年访问Access97时用过,很久没做了。

热点排行